Imagine M\u00e4ander, backwaters, and unique habitats. This is Altrhein Maxau. It is a nature reserve in Karlsruhe’s west, part of the Altrhein area. Burgau, a younger nature and landscape reserve, surrounds it.
Altrhein Maxau spans approximately 35 hectares in the Knielingen district. It includes the northern part of the Knielinger See. The area borders the fields of Hofgut Maxau to the west. To the north, the Winden-Karlsruhe railway line marks its boundary. The Leimengrubengrund, part of the Karlsruhe city forest, lies to the east.
Altrhein Maxau connects to the Burgau nature and landscape reserve. Altrhein Maxau became a protected area in 1980. Burgau followed in 1989. The area is also an EU bird sanctuary. It is part of the Rhine lowlands between Elchesheim and Karlsruhe. It is a special area of conservation. This is the Rhine lowlands between Wintersdorf and Karlsruhe. It is part of the Natura 2000 network. The LIFE project created it. It is called “Living Rhine Floodplains near Karlsruhe.”
The Altrhein Maxau protects the Altrhein. M\u00e4anders are found here. They remained as side arms. This happened during natural shifts in the Rhine’s riverbed. The area protects typical siltation communities. It also protects woodland zones.
The existing ecosystem is protected and developed. It is home to rare and endangered species. These species live in the Rhine floodplain. The area serves as a regeneration zone. It benefits the directly connected Maxau gravel pit lake.
Professor Dr. K\u00fchlwein from the Botanical Institute Karlsruhe helped protect the Altrhein Maxau. On February 8, 1963, he requested the Knielinger See be declared a nature reserve. The focus shifted to Altrhein Maxau. He based his request on the ecological value. He also cited its suitability as a treatment plant for the lake.
Markgraf Berthold von Baden owned Altrhein Maxau. He had approved gravel extraction there in 1957. Protection required his consent. It also needed changes to the gravel extraction agreement. Negotiations with the Markgraf’s representatives followed.
In 1970, the city seemed to have settled fundamental issues. In Strasbourg, a European nature conservation conference took place. It stirred up the garden department. On January 8, 1971, the department questioned the validity. They wondered if the standards for gravel extraction still applied. This was after 1.5 decades.
In early 1971, the Markgraf made new demands. The city went public. The official process began. It went through the planning committee and the city council. The committee met on May 14, 1971. The garden department distanced itself. It had initially embraced the nature conservation conference. It prioritized the bathing lake and Rheinstadt projects. These required preserving Katersgrund island. Professor K\u00fchlwein advocated for preserving shallow water. It was west of Altrhein Maxau.
Compromise was found. The council members met at the Knielinger See. They agreed to Variant 3. This included both concerns. The city council approved Variant 3 in early July 1971. This ended years of discussion. The Markgraf approved.
The city invested much in protecting Altrhein Maxau. It involved negotiations and additional expenses. The city covered removal costs. This was for the overburden from the new dredging area. It was southeast of the lake. The city relocated the Federbach. The gravel plant contributed 150,000 DM. In 1980, Altrhein Maxau became a nature reserve. This corrected the 1957 decisions.
Altrhein Maxau faces challenges. The shallow water zone tends to eutrophication. The reed belt is shrinking. Thirty years ago, reeds covered large areas. Now, only remnants remain. Inside the Entenfang, reeds have disappeared. This indicates high nitrogen levels. The decline in reed affects the biological quality. It impacts the breeding of great crested grebes.
The absence of water chestnuts raises doubts. It questions the listed species. It suggests a need to update assessments. Currently, widespread reed dieback requires replacement sites.
